So. My DVC Gold Pass expires in Sept. When I tried to renew it this evening the only option it lets me select is the Platinum pass.

It specifically says the Gold Pass is no longer avail.
DVC passes can't be renewed online, you must call MS. Only Tourist (non-discounted) and FL Resident passes can be renewed online. I renewed our FL Resident Gold Passes in June and many DVC members have called and renewed theirs recently.
 
Call MS to renew your GOLD pass.

AFAIK, we have always had to call MS to renew DVC annual passes. Policy is what @erionm just posted.
